summaryrefslogtreecommitdiffstats
AgeCommit message (Expand)AuthorFilesLines
2020-02-26Enable golint testschromium.org/superq/linterBen Kochie8-58/+70
2020-02-17Unwrap infiband error (#264)v0.0.10Ben Kochie1-1/+1
2020-02-04Expose xs_qm_dquot_unused XFS counterv0.0.9Steven Kreuzer3-4/+37
2020-01-29Merge pull request #254 from kozl/conntrack-statisticsPaul Gier2-0/+238
2020-01-28Added parsing netfilter conntrack statistics from net/stat/nf_conntrackAleksandr Kozlov2-0/+238
2020-01-23Use net.IP instead of []uint8 for IPs.Peter Bueschel2-16/+18
2020-01-23Refactor tests for parsing linesPeter Bueschel1-98/+87
2020-01-23Fix the overflow while parsing ipv6 addr inside net_udp.goPeter Bueschel3-113/+154
2020-01-23Add support for /proc/loadavgtukeJonny3-0/+160
2020-01-21swaps_test.go: Use subtests and add a fixture testSteven McDonald2-13/+52
2020-01-21Add support for /proc/swapsSteven McDonald2-0/+169
2020-01-09procfs: clean up softnet parsing APIs and codeMatt Layher2-59/+66
2019-12-19makefile: update Makefile.common with newer versionprombot1-5/+7
2019-12-12less restrictive checking for xfs quota statsPaul Gier1-2/+2
2019-12-09Add explanation to the readLimit. Fix comment on newNetUDPSummary.Peter Bueschel1-2/+8
2019-12-09Add extra summary struct for /proc/net/upd{,6}.Peter Bueschel3-63/+293
2019-12-09Add /proc/net/udp parsing especially for the tx_queue and rx_queue lengths.Peter Bueschel3-0/+239
2019-12-08Add UIDs to ProcStatus structBen Keith3-1/+22
2019-12-03Merge pull request #242 from prometheus/mdl-netunixMatt Layher2-213/+190
2019-11-26procfs: clean up /proc/crypto parser and testsMatt Layher3-82/+181
2019-11-26procfs: change Unix to UNIX per Go conventionschromium.org/mdl-netunixMatt Layher2-43/+41
2019-11-25procfs: tidy up NetUnix APIs and internalsMatt Layher2-193/+172
2019-11-25Merge pull request #241 from prometheus/mdl-sockstat-ipv6v0.0.8Matt Layher2-0/+17
2019-11-25procfs: ensure NetSockstat6 compatibility with os.IsNotExistMatt Layher2-0/+17
2019-11-25Merge pull request #237 from prometheus/mdl-sockstatMatt Layher5-2/+407
2019-11-25procfs: implement parsing of NetSockstat{,6}Matt Layher5-2/+407
2019-11-25Merge pull request #240 from prometheus/mdl-meminfoMatt Layher1-202/+26
2019-11-23procfs: simplify meminfo parserchromium.org/mdl-meminfoMatt Layher1-202/+26
2019-11-23Merge pull request #238 from prometheus/mdl-staticcheckMatt Layher5-9/+4
2019-11-23procfs: re-enable golangci-lint and fix issueschromium.org/mdl-staticcheckMatt Layher5-9/+4
2019-11-14Remove debug logging from meminfov0.0.7Ben Kochie1-3/+0
2019-11-11feat: Add support for meminfov0.0.6Brad Beam4-185/+430
2019-11-11Initial meminfo proc infoAbhi Yerra3-0/+334
2019-11-08Update mountinfo parsing (#228)Ben Kochie3-60/+77
2019-11-07Convert stat parser to ReadFileNoStat() (#231)Ben Kochie1-6/+6
2019-10-22Fix: RxPackets is doubled in package procfs (#226)Guangming Wang1-1/+0
2019-10-18powercap sysfs readerUkri Niemimuukko2-0/+181
2019-10-18fixtures: update with RAPL filesUkri Niemimuukko1-0/+128
2019-10-15Add tests and fixtures for BtrfsSilke Hofstra2-0/+677
2019-10-15Add support for /sys/fs/btrfsSilke Hofstra2-0/+318
2019-10-07move ReadFileNoStat to its own filePaul Gier2-20/+38
2019-10-04limit ReadFile function to 512kPaul Gier1-1/+7
2019-10-04introduce new function ReadFileNoStatPaul Gier11-89/+68
2019-10-03update go module dependenciesPaul Gier2-6/+8
2019-09-17update readme and contributing guidePaul Gier2-7/+116
2019-09-17fix typoPaul Gier1-1/+1
2019-09-15additional error handling when reading files in /sys/classv0.0.5Paul Gier3-0/+14
2019-09-11add cpu topology and thermal throttle informationPaul Gier3-2/+253
2019-09-09use string type for ID fields and float64 for CPU MHzPaul Gier2-27/+15
2019-09-09add parsing of /proc/cpuinfoPaul Gier3-0/+458